#9d4c08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d4c08 is composed of 61.6% red, 29.8%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 27.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 32.4%. #9d4c08 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9810 with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#9d4c08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d4c08 has RGB values of R:157, G:76,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.95,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10308616.

Shades and Tints of #9d4c08
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080400 is the darkest color, while #fef9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9d4c08
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57524e is the less saturated color, while #a34b02 is the most saturated one.
